POTATO FANS
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ees. In a small sauce pan melt together the butter, garlic, and parsley. Peel each potato and cut each potato crosswise into 1/4" slices without slicing all the way through the potato. Place potatoes in baking dish and drizzle with butter mixture. Bake for 1 hour or until golden, crispy and the potatoes have fanned out. Serve hot.
CHEESE & HERB POTATO FANS
It's downright fun to make and serve this potato recipe. The fresh herbs, butter and cheeses are just what a good potato needs. -Susan Curry, West Hills, California
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Side Dishes
Time 1h15m
Yield 8 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 425°. With a sharp knife, cut each potato crosswise into 1/8-in. slices, leaving slices attached at the bottom; fan potatoes slightly and place in a greased 13x9-in. baking dish. In a small bowl, mix butter, salt and pepper; drizzle over potatoes., Bake, uncovered, 50-55 minutes or until potatoes are tender. In a small bowl, toss cheeses with herbs; sprinkle over potatoes. Bake about 5 minutes longer or until cheese is melted.

BUTTERY POTATO CAKE
A perfect potato dish for Sunday lunch or dinner party - serve in wedges, or put the whole cake on the table for everyone to cut into
Provided by Good Food team
Categories Buffet, Dinner, Lunch, Side dish, Snack, Supper, Vegetable
Time 2h
Number Of Ingredients 2
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 190C/gas 5/fan 170C. Peel and thinly slice the potatoes and put immediately into a bowl of cold water. Using some of the butter, liberally grease a 20-23cm cake tin (not loosebottomed).
- Drain the potato slices and dry thoroughly in a tea towel. Place the potato slices in circles in a layer in the base of the tin, overlapping them as you go. Season with salt and freshly ground black pepper and dot with a few small pieces of butter. Keep layering the slices evenly, seasoning and dotting with butter as you go. Finish with butter, season, then cover with a circle of buttered greaseproof paper.
- Bake for 1½ hours, or until the potatoes are tender when pierced with the tip of a knife.
- Leave to cool in the tin for 5 minutes, then invert on to a serving plate. Brown briefly under a hot grill if the top needs more browning. Serve cut into wedges.

BEEF AND BUTTER-FAN POTATOES
It's a meat-and-potato lover's dream to be invited to this main event!
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Entree
Time 3h20m
Yield 12
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at oven to 325°F. Place beef roast, fat side up, on rack in shallow roasting pan.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Insert meat thermometer so tip is in center of thickest part of beef and does not rest in fat. Roast uncovered 1 hour 45 minutes to 2 hours 15 minutes or until thermometer reads 140°F (for medium-rare) to 155°F (for medium). While beef is roasting, continue with recipe.
- Peel potatoes. Make crosswise cuts 1/4 inch apart in each potato to within 1/2 inch of bottom. Heat 1 inch water (salted if desired) to boiling. Add potatoes. Cover and heat to boiling; boil 10 minutes. Drain and cool slightly.
- Brush each potato with butter, separating cuts slightly to resemble fan. Sprinkle with seasoned salt and bread crumbs. Place on rack with beef. Roast about 1 hour 30 minutes or until potatoes are tender and golden. Remove beef from oven and let stand 15 to 20 minutes or until thermometer reads 145°F (medium-rare) to 160°F (medium). Sprinkle potatoes with paprika. Serve with beef juices.

GRILLED POTATO FANS
If you're looking for a change from plain baked potatoes, try these tender and buttery potato fans seasoned with oregano, garlic powder, celery and onion. To cut down on grilling time, I sometimes microwave the potatoes for 5-6 minutes before slicing them. -Jennifer Black-Ortiz, San Jose, California
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Side Dishes
Time 55m
Yield 6 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- With a sharp knife, make cuts 1/2 in. apart in each potato, leaving slices attached at the bottom. Fan the potatoes slightly. Place each on a piece of heavy-duty foil (about 12 in. square). Insert onions and butter between potato slices. Sprinkle with celery, salt, oregano, garlic powder and pepper. Fold foil around potatoes and seal tightly. Grill, covered, over medium-hot heat for 40-45 minutes or until tender.

CRISPY BAKED POTATO FANS
I had seen this done on another cooking show and had to try it. I tweaked it a little for my own personal taste and feel it would work for others.
Provided by CabinKat
Categories < 60 Mins
Time 1h
Yield 4 Potatoes, 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- You can use one slice of bread in place of the bread crumbs. Chop up and place in food processor, pulse until you get fine crumbles. Bake on cookie sheet in 200° degree oven until dry, about 20 minutes. Let cool.
- Place bread crumbs in medium-sized bowl and add butter, cheeses, paprika, garlic powder, 1/4 teaspoons salt, and 1/4 teaspoons pepper. Mix well.
- Bread crumb mixture can be refrigerated for 2 days in zipper-lock bag.
- For the potato fans, heat oven to 450° degrees. After potatoes have been scrubbed, find flattest part of potato and cut skin off slightly so potato doesn't rock. Cut both ends off about 1/4" or so. Then proceed to fan potato, making 1/4" slices. Use something on either side of potato (dow rod or chop sticks) so that you don't cut all the way through. You should have a bit more than a 1/4" left at the bottom. Once all are cut (very important part), rinse through running water getting gently in-between the slices. Let drain and then place sliced-side down on microwavable plate. Microwave until slightly soft to touch, 6-12 minutes, flipping potatoes halfway through.
- Arrange potatoes, sliced-side up, on foil-lined baking sheet. Brush potatoes with olive oil all over and try to get in-between some of the slices, season with salt and pepper. Bake until skin is crisp and potatoes start to brown, about 25-30 minutes.
- Remove from oven and let sit for about 5 minutes. Carefully top potatoes with bread crumb mixture, pressing gently to adhere. Try to get a bit in-between slices, but don't push too hard or they will separate too much. Broil until bread crumbs are deep golden brown, about 3 minutes. Serve warm.
- NOTE: You can substitute the Monterey Jack for Cheddar or another semi-firm cheese. The Parmesan helps bind the bread crumbs.
CRISPY BAKED POTATO FANS RECIPE - (5/5)
Provided by á-2630
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- 1. For the bread crumb topping: Adjust oven rack to middle position and heat oven to 200 degrees. Pulse bread in food processor until coarsely ground. Bake bread crumbs on rimmed baking sheet until dry, about 20 minutes. Let cool 5 minutes, then combine crumbs, butter, cheeses, paprika, garlic powder, 1/4 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on pepper in large bowl. (Bread crumb topping can be refrigerated in zipper-lock bag for 2 days.) 2. For the potato fans: Heat oven to 450 degrees. Following photos 1 to 3 at left, cut 1/4 inch from bottom and ends of potatoes, then slice potatoes crosswise at 1/4-inch intervals, leaving 1/4 inch of potato intact. Gently rinse potatoes under running water, let drain, and transfer, sliced-side down, to plate. Microwave until slightly soft to the touch, 6 to 12 minutes, flipping potatoes halfway through cooking. 3. Arrange potatoes, sliced-side up, on foil-lined baking sheet. Brush potatoes all over with oil and season with salt and pepper. Bake until skin is crisp and potatoes are beginning to brown, 25 to 30 minutes. Remove potatoes from oven and heat broiler. 4. Carefully top potatoes with stuffing mixture, pressing gently to adhere. Broil until bread crumbs are deep golden brown, about 3 minutes. Serve. Prepping Baked Potato Fans These potatoes may look difficult to make, but we found a few simple, no-fuss tricks to ensure perfect potato fans every time. 1. Trim 1/4-inch slices from the bottom and ends of each potato to allow them to sit flat and to give the slices extra room to fan out during baking. 2. Chopsticks provide a foolproof guide for slicing the potato petals without cutting all the way through the potato. 3. Gently flex fans open while rinsing under cold running water; this rids the potatoes of excess starch that can impede fanning.
